In the ever-evolving landscape of CS2, mastering the use of utility timing can drastically enhance your gameplay. Understanding when to deploy grenades, smokes, and flashes can turn the tide of any match. For instance, using a smoke grenade to obscure enemy visibility just before your team executes a site push can create chaos and open opportunities for a successful entry. Players should also pay attention to the timing of their utility usage to synchronize with teammates. A well-timed flashbang thrown just as an enemy is peeking can blind them, providing your team with a crucial advantage.
Moreover, effective utility timing requires not only individual skill but also excellent communication with your team. Utilize voice chat or in-game signals to coordinate your utility deployments, ensuring that your grenades are used in conjunction with one another. For example, a smoke can be followed up by a molotov to clear out common hiding spots, forcing opponents into less favorable positions. By practicing utility timings in various scenarios, players can become more adept at making split-second decisions that can lead to victory. Don't underestimate the impact of small timings; they can be the difference between a win and a loss in CS2.

In CS2, understanding the importance of timing can be the difference between winning and losing. Effective use of utilities—such as grenades, smokes, and flashes—requires players to not only know when to deploy them but also how to integrate them into their team's strategy. For instance, throwing a smoke grenade at the right moment can obscure the enemy's vision and create opportunities for your teammates to advance. Conversely, wasting a smoke at a crucial moment can leave your team vulnerable. Learning to anticipate enemy movements and coordinating with your team enhances both defensive and offensive plays.
Moreover, utilizing utilities effectively also involves knowing your team’s composition and the dynamics of each map. For example, on a long map like Dust II, using flashbangs to blind opponents holding critical angles can give your team a significant edge.
